Security and fairness are where blockchain stands out. Many platforms offer “provably fair” games: outcomes are generated using cryptographic seeds and hashes, allowing players to verify results independently. Instead of accepting the casino’s word, a player can check the pre-committed server seed against the final outcome and confirm no tampering occurred. This auditable system builds confidence, especially in fast games like crash, dice, mines, or plinko. Further, reputable operators implement secure custody practices, combining hot wallets for operational liquidity with cold storage for safeguarding reserves, and they often encourage two-factor authentication to protect player accounts.

Bankroll strategy is essential. A common guideline is to stake a small fraction of the total bankroll per wager—often 1–2%—to limit variance and preserve longevity. Players who enjoy live baccarat or blackjack might set session budgets and time caps, using reality checks or session reminders to enforce breaks. When bonuses are involved, the player reads the fine print and selects offers with achievable wagering, fair contribution percentages, and transparent cash-out conditions. A measured approach includes avoiding high-volatility bets when the goal is steady play, verifying random seeds for fairness in supported games, and resisting the urge to chase losses. These habits protect both balance and mindset.
